1992 FEB letter from William Lloyd Potts with his pedigree chart.
WILLIAM LLOYD POTTS was born Wayne Twp., Noble Co. OH in 1932.
"I am
the last HAGUE descendant born on HAGUE owned property.  The lake
(Seneca Lake) took our farm in 1937 and we moved to Guernsey Co.  My
grandfather (JOSEPH RILEY HAGUE) who had been born on the farm, died in
June or July of that year before we had to move.  He suffered a heatstroke
working in a corn field that he knew would never be harvested.  Hot sun
and a broken heart are very hard on an 80 year old man!"
